HELP MP5 Reliably Running Blanks?

Post image

Im trying to get blanks to run reliably. I have the canadian 9mm blanks that seem to cycle the bolt well except for a few primers being a bit hard. The problem is that I get about 3-4 failures to feed per mag where the round seems to point straight up when coming out of the mag and just gets pinned vertically against the chamber face by the bolt. Basically looks like the above picture inside the gun.

When running regular rounds it is very reliable. Ran 300 rounds of 124 and 165 after this with zero failures.

I've tried with both 100° and 80° locking pieces.

Not really sure what else to try to fix this.

u/mikaru86 2d ago

Does that have and adjustment screw? The G3 one has it. That can be used to tune the degree of blockage which in turn affects the pressure curve in the barrell and can help with getting blanks to run reliably (or tune the RoF with full auto/FRT).

Because the round tilting up could be an indicator that the bolt doesn't fully retract while cycling, resulting in the feeding issue.
